WebFeb 28, 2024 · There were 9.56 million births in 2024 with a crude birth rate of 6.77 per thousand; and there were 10.41 million deaths with a crude death rate of 7.37 per thousand. The natural growth rate was -0.60 per thousand. Table 1: Population and Its Composition by the End of 2024 eap intermountain
